Checklist
- Check carton quantities against the commercial invoice line by line.
- Request batch photographs and a packing list prior to shipment.
- Record the arrival condition with photographs on the day of delivery.
- Confirm the exact configuration in writing before the deposit is paid.
- Verify that artwork matches the approved compliance template.
- Agree in advance who pays for return freight on a defect claim.

Frequently asked questions
What information should a Marvos X enquiry include?
Model, quantity per SKU, destination, preferred incoterm and target delivery window.
Can several models be mixed in one shipment?
Yes, mixing models and flavours within a carton or pallet is common and usually helps first time buyers test demand.
What happens if a batch fails inspection?
The agreed procedure normally covers replacement of affected units or credit against the next order, documented before shipment.
Do you support long term supply agreements?
Yes, rolling agreements with defined review points work better for both sides than rigid annual commitments.
